Here's the deal: JavaScript can do almost anything to a webpage. Want to make a site more readable? Add text-to-speech to Claude? JavaScript's got your back.
But managing that JavaScript? That's where things get messy.
Console commands are great for one-offs, but they're a pain to reuse. And while bookmarklets are powerful, updating them is like trying to perform surgery with oven mitts on.
That's where Bookmogrify comes in. Right now, it's a humble home for bookmarklets. But the vision? It's bigger.
Imagine:
Writing your JavaScript in a proper editor
Hitting save
And boom, it's updated everywhere you use it
No more copy-pasting. No more minifying by hand. No more juggling multiple versions of a bookmarklet script.
We're not there yet, but that's the dream. A system that lets you focus on running cool scripts, not managing them.
